Q: Where can I get a copy of my 1099 for my work with the State of Colorado?
A: If you haven't received, or have lost, your 1099 Tax Statement for work performed for State of Colorado Government, please send an email to state_centralapproval@state.co.us. Alternatively, send written requests to:
Central Management Unit
1525 Sherman St., 3rd floor
Denver, CO 80203
Include your: Legal name and the last four digits of your tax ID (TIN)
